Consider Your Dog’s Age, Size, and Breed
The age, size, and breed of your dog are crucial factors to consider when selecting a crate pad. Puppies, senior dogs, and small breeds require different types of materials and padding to ensure their comfort and safety. For instance, puppies may require a crate pad with extra padding and a waterproof surface to prevent accidents, while senior dogs may benefit from a crate pad with memory foam for added support. Larger breeds, on the other hand, may need a crate pad with thicker padding to provide adequate support for their joints.
As the American Kennel Club suggests, “Choose a crate pad that is specifically designed for your dog’s size and age group.” This will ensure that your dog receives the right amount of comfort and support for their needs.

Choosing the Right Dog Crate Pad Size
Ensuring a Comfortable Place for Your Furry Friend to Rest
Choosing the right dog crate pad size is crucial to ensure your pet’s comfort and well-being. The crate pad should fit snugly inside the crate, providing adequate space for your dog to lie down, turn around, and get up without feeling constricted. In this section, we’ll discuss the different sizes of dog crate pads available and provide guidelines for selecting the perfect one for your dog’s needs.
Small Dog Crate Pads: For dogs weighing up to 20 pounds
If you have a small breed dog, such as a Chihuahua, Poodle, or Maltese, a small dog crate pad is the way to go. Small crate pads are designed for dogs weighing up to 20 pounds and typically measure between 20-24 inches long and 14-16 inches wide [1]. These pads are perfect for small crates, providing a comfortable surface for your dog to rest on.
When choosing a small crate pad, consider the following factors:
- Length: Ensure the pad is long enough for your dog to stretch out comfortably, ideally between 20-24 inches.
- Width: Select a pad that is narrow enough to fit snugly inside the crate, usually between 14-16 inches wide.
- Material: Opt for a pad with a breathable, soft material, such as memory foam or Sherpa, to provide maximum comfort for your dog.
Medium Dog Crate Pads: For dogs weighing 21-40 pounds
Medium crate pads are suitable for most breeds, including medium-sized dogs like Cocker Spaniels, Beagles, and French Bulldogs. These pads measure between 24-30 inches long and 16-20 inches wide, providing ample space for your dog to move around [2]. Medium crate pads are ideal for dogs that weigh between 21-40 pounds.
When selecting a medium crate pad, keep in mind:
- Length: Ensure the pad is long enough for your dog to stretch out and move around comfortably, ideally between 24-30 inches.
- Width: Choose a pad that fits snugly inside the crate, usually between 16-20 inches wide.
- Support: Opt for a pad with extra support and cushioning, such as those with reinforced edges or bolstered designs.
Large Dog Crate Pads: For dogs weighing 41-60 pounds
Large crate pads are designed for large breeds, such as German Shepherds, Labradors, and Golden Retrievers. These pads measure between 30-36 inches long and 20-24 inches wide, providing a spacious surface for your dog to rest on [3]. Large crate pads are suitable for dogs that weigh between 41-60 pounds.
When choosing a large crate pad, consider the following factors:
- Length: Ensure the pad is long enough for your dog to stretch out and move around comfortably, ideally between 30-36 inches.
- Width: Select a pad that fits snugly inside the crate, usually between 20-24 inches wide.
- Durability: Opt for a pad with a sturdy construction and durable materials to withstand your dog’s weight and regular use.

Material Options for Dog Crate Pads
Dog crate pads come in a variety of materials, each with its own set of benefits and drawbacks. The most common materials used in dog crate pads are:
- Memory Foam: Memory foam crate pads are a popular choice due to their ability to conform to your dog’s body shape and provide support. They are also easy to clean and maintain. However, some dogs may find the pressure of the foam uncomfortable, so it’s essential to choose a crate pad with a thin layer or a hybrid foam and fleece design. 1
- Fleece: Fleece crate pads are soft, breathable, and gentle on your dog’s skin. They are suitable for dogs with sensitive skin and are often used for orthopedic support. However, they may lose their shape over time and require frequent washing. 2
- Orthopedic: Orthopedic crate pads are designed to provide extra support and comfort for dogs with joint issues or arthritis. They often feature multiple layers of foam for added support and may be more expensive than other materials. 3
- Wool: Wool crate pads are a natural, breathable option that maintains its shape and provides insulation. They are suitable for dogs with sensitive skin or allergies but can be more expensive and may require specific washing instructions. 4
- Bolster and Removable Covers: Some dog crate pads come with removable covers and bolsters, which can provide extra comfort and support for your dog. However, they may require more frequent washing and may increase the overall cost. 5
Factors Affecting Dog Crate Pad Comfort
When selecting a dog crate pad, there are several factors to consider that can affect comfort:
- Support and Pressure Relief: A dog crate pad should provide the right amount of support and pressure relief to prevent your dog’s body from getting sore. Thin or flat pads can cause discomfort, while thick pads may provide too much support.
- Firmness: A crate pad should be firm enough to provide support but not too firm to cause discomfort.
- Bolstering: Bolsters or pillows can add to the overall comfort of the crate pad by providing extra support and preventing your dog from sliding around.
- Ventilation: Proper ventilation is essential to prevent overheating and condensation buildup in the crate. Look for crate pads with breathable materials or mesh panels to ensure airflow and comfort.
- Easy Cleaning: Easy-to-clean crate pads are a must-have to maintain your dog’s hygiene and prevent bacterial and fungal growth.

Machine Washable and Dryable Dog Crate Pads
One of the most significant advantages of machine washable and dryable dog crate pads is their ease of maintenance. Accidents happen, and dirty crate pads can be a real challenge to clean. However, with machine washable and dryable crate pads, you can simply toss them in the washing machine and dryer, eliminating the need for tedious hand-washing and air-drying. This feature is especially useful for pet owners with busy schedules or those who prefer a hassle-free cleaning experience.
According to PetMD, “Machine washable and dryable dog crate pads are a great option for pet owners who want to keep their dog’s crate clean and hygienic.” [^1] These pads are usually made from durable, easy-to-clean materials that can withstand multiple wash cycles without losing their shape or comfort.
When shopping for machine washable and dryable dog crate pads, look for products with the following features:
- Made from easy-to-clean materials, such as cotton or polyester blends
- Can be machine washed and dried without losing their shape or comfort
- Durable and long-lasting construction
